TV thief wanted after walking out with nearly $1K in electronics in Chesapeake
Chesapeake, VA — A suspect is being sought after allegedly stealing multiple televisions from a department store and leaving without paying, prompting a public request for help identifying him.
The incident occurred February 23 at a store in the 2300 block of Taylor Road.
Authorities said the unidentified male selected several televisions totaling approximately $999.98 before exiting the store without making payment.
Photos of the suspect have been released as part of the investigation.

No additional description has been provided.
The case remains under investigation as officials ask anyone with information to come forward.
